This annual event is held on the first Saturday in May.

Centered at the St. Joseph / St Benedict Catholic Church near the intersection of 8th Street and Vermont Avenue in Kansas City, Kansas this festival offers awesome Polish food, at reasonable prices, cooked by the ladies of the parish and served in the church basement. There are displays of Polish items, baked goods, games for the kids, a parade, which by tradition goes the wrong way up a one way street and of course - polka music.

At 4:00pm a Polish Polka Mass is held.
